PEORIA, Ill. -- Junior goalkeeper Kyle Orne (Phoenix, Ariz./Desert Vista) has been named the Bradley Country Financial Scholar-Athlete of the Week announced Tuesday after helping the Bradley soccer team open its season with a 2-0-1 record.
Orne started the first and third games during Bradley's season-opening East Coast road swing, picking up both victories for the Braves between the pipes. He boasted a .909 save percentage for the week, making five saves in each of his two appearances. Orne helped Bradley post a shutout 1-0 win at Delaware Sunday. During Wednesday's 2-1 win at Saint Peter's, he saved a potential game-tying penalty kick in the 89th minute. Currently pursuing a triple major in political science, English and Spanish, Orne owns a 3.83 cumulative grade point average.
Each week, a Bradley student-athlete is selected as the Country Financial Scholar-Athlete of the Week. The individual chosen must be at least a sophomore in class standing and boast a minimum 3.0 cumulative grade point average, while displaying a level of athletic excellence.
Orne and the Braves return to action Friday, when they face East Tennessee State at 5 p.m. at the ProRehab Aces Soccer Classic in Evansville, Ind.
